CELTIC have been paired with Malmo in the Champions League play-off round draw which was made in Nyon this morning.
The first leg with be played at Parkhead on Wednesday, August 19 with the return in Sweden on Tuesday, August 25.
Malmo, who have been champions of their domestic league for the past two years, beat Red Bull Salzburg 3-2 on aggregate in the last round, having lost the first leg in Austria 2-0.They currently sit mid-table in the league with eight wins and seven draws from 18 games so far and can number former Celtic loan player Jo Inge Berget in their ranks.

Malmo defeated Rangers 2-1 in the third qualifying stage of this competition four years ago and humbled Hibs 9-0 – including a 7-0 rout at Easter Road – in Europa League qualifying in 2013.

The winners will progress to the Champions League group stages with the losers dropping into the same phase of the Europa League.
